Solution for 4(q-77)=72 equation:



4(q-77)=72
We move all terms to the left:
4(q-77)-(72)=0
We multiply parentheses
4q-308-72=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4q-380=0
We move all terms containing q to the left, all other terms to the right
4q=380
q=380/4
q=95
